Meeting notes — Gateway API sync

Discussed cursor-based pagination for the public Lanternfish REST API ahead of the 4.2 release. Agreed to deprecate offset parameters over two release cycles, with warnings in response headers starting next sprint. Docs team will update the public guide before the cutover. Release manager asked who signs off on the pagination contract freeze; the group confirmed that one engineer holds final approval and must review the changelog entry. The responsible person is named below.

named custodian: Belius Casath Ulaix Sorius

## Changelog — Hookline 3.0: retry defaults changed

Webhook delivery retries now use exponential backoff with jitter instead of fixed 30-second intervals. Maximum attempts dropped from 10 to 6, and delivery timeouts tightened to 15 seconds. Plugins that relied on the old fixed cadence should declare their own retry policy explicitly rather than inheriting defaults. For reference during review, the new shipped defaults for the delivery service are as follows.

settings of hagug-yawip:
druix:
  pin: 0136
  metrics_host: metrics.druix.qorvellabs.internal
  tenant: kelox
  seal: seal_71ff4acd

You'll remember the intermittent resolution failures from the Larkspur audit — the old resolver cached negative responses for far too long, so a single transient NXDOMAIN would poison lookups for minutes. In the new stack we pin an internal resolver, enforce a short negative-cache TTL, and log every fallback to the public resolver so you can review egress during sign-off. Nothing resolves outside the allowlist without an audit entry. Review the resolver settings below and confirm they match your threat-model expectations before approving.

deployment values, taweg-bajop:
[fenvan]
port = 5672
team = holmir
host = fenvan.orvexio.example
region = lower-1
access_code = ac_b98bc6
timeout_ms = 1500